Output 826bbf8ac26123bfaf8addce823900dcff6736e0012b4b28b693361b043d0149:5

value
515000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b7f191dcc54ef2c29ee9309c2e88f76ed3dbed40 OP_EQUAL
address
3JTcyDBqyE1T6bcLCweTTnwuHvcL2DFUcs
transaction
826bbf8ac26123bfaf8addce823900dcff6736e0012b4b28b693361b043d0149
spent
true